Hyundai Ioniq: Emergency Call System / Emergency Call (eCall) Antenna. Repair procedures
1. | Disconnect the negative (-) battery terminal. |
2. | Remove the roof trim assembly. (Refer to Body - "Roof Trim Assembly") |
3. | Disconnect the roof antenna cable and connectors (A). 
|
4. | Remove the roof antenna after loosening a nut (A). 
|
•
| Make sure that the cables and connectors are plugged in properly. |
•
| Check the eCall system for normal operation. |
|
1. | Install the antenna and then connect the roof antenna connectors. |
2. | Install the roof trim assembly. |
